LIVE | De Ruyter does not want to name minister who told him to allow some corruption
De Ruyter says there has been an extraordinary effect by Eskom, him and his management to help law enforcement to get to grips with these issues. COMMENT: Van Minnen's line of questioning is key. It shows De Ruyter made public enterprises minister Pravin Gordhan aware that he suspected politically connected individuals were involved in corruption at Eskom.De Ruyter on"senior politicians" involvement in corruption. He says they became aware of it in 2022.
He said that there is a narrative in the media that there is a"minister". It was a"senior politician". De Ruyter said informing Gordhan and Mufamadi about which minister it was, was in line with his job. COMMENT: Not telling the committee who the minister was who told him, basically, he needed to allow some people to get away with corruption to prevent attacks on him, is going to be a difficult exercise.
At no time was the discussion about broader elements of poor governance... I don't want this to be characterized by the minister as being there being more for people to eat...
